    The only things I don’t like is the change of the manual sampling mode and mixing/adding effects to the master channel. I’ve been a dedicated user of Native Instruments’ Maschine series, starting with the original and moving to the Mikro platform for its smaller footprint. I’ve used the Mikro since its release, upgraded to the Mk.2 in 2017, and just got the Mk.3 in 2024. Despite the attractive new hardware, I’m disappointed with the sampling workflow changes.
    Previously, live manual slicing was a feature that significantly enhanced my workflow and was a major reason I preferred the Maschine. However, the Mk.3 now has a slower, less intuitive sampling process. This change seems ironic and counterintuitive, especially for a model marketed as “fast” and “on-the-go,” as Boris mentioned. It disrupts the efficient workflow I’ve relied on for over a decade.
    The original Mikro and other models support this essential feature, suggesting the issue is software-related. I contacted support to request that they revert the settings to re-enable live manual slicing, and I encourage others to do the same. This feature is crucial for maintaining the high productivity and enjoyment I’ve experienced with Maschine products. Also, we used to be able to navigate between sound, group, AND MASTER, with f1, f2, and f3. Now we only have sound and group… we should be able to do EVERYTHING from hardware. I’m sure this can also be resolved in a software update… something for long-time users of the mikro platform functionality.
    Let’s work together to get Native Instruments to restore these capabilities and enhance the user experience on the Mikro Mk.3. Some of us CHOSE the platform out of the desire to have a smaller footprint, but we didn’t want a smaller pool of functionality. I’m sure this was done to encourage sales of other offerings, but there are other reasons to buy the flagship models- maybe the screen? The amount of encoders? The ability to attach SD cards and use it as a standalone… don’t worry NI, we will still buy a good product, but bring back the days of being able to make beats while waiting in the airport.     Gotta say, NI... HUGE mistake not having Controller Editor support for the Mikro MK3, or the M32. Huge. Colossal. There are a lot of people out there (thousands upon thousands) who like the controllers, because of MIDI-mapping customizability. Since the M32 has "Fixed assignments" and the Mikro MK3, the same..... no good, guys. You have to support general MIDI and other DAWs, as MIDI is bigger than EVER before. I'm speaking as a longtime NI customer (I own three Studios (two black, one white), a MK3, two MK2s (black and white), S49 MK1, S25 MK1, two Mikro MK2s, black and white).
    Was going to buy the M32... but nope... also, no Windows 7 support. Mikro MK3 would be a dope MIDI control surface plus drum pad... but since you can't change the MIDI channel nor assign ANY of the buttons to specific CCs or whatever you want (NOR have Groups with different MIDI notes, so... shifted octaves for a lot of options)... no go, too.
    Don't go the route of M-Audio who kept "breaking" cool things... or Akai, Roland, etc.
    You guys were the most forward-thinking company, and you're becoming the most backwards- thinking one. Don't follow this path. Please.
